Transaction eeac0f31ebfe4c31e829202e71d37da35f66fc20c978d6d860291508d990bff8
1 Input
1 Output
-
eeac0f31ebfe4c31e829202e71d37da35f66fc20c978d6d860291508d990bff8:0
- value
- 345973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a1d88083f945524b218881e906ef04be3e43a9a2 OP_EQUAL
- address
- 3GSn5FaGcdaaVeJTpuMWa6D1uTHUUiHy3H